Design Features

The arrangement of such wells is quite simple, however, when they are erected, all the requirements of GOST and SNiP should be taken into account. These vertical hollow structures consist of:

  • Bottom part with a blind bottom;
  • Walled well rings with a diameter of 1000-1500 mm (they choose the right depth);
  • Special rings with a diameter of 600 mm, which regulate the height of the well and put into the neck;
  • Cover installed on the hatch.

As a rule, prefabricated reinforced concrete wells are almost or completely submerged in the ground and located below or above the water table.

When installing to form the tray part, concrete is poured on their bottom.

Reinforced concrete rings for a well

These concrete products form the well's well. The rings are a crate made of metal reinforcement and covered with concrete. Products are produced in accordance with GOST 8020-90 by vibrocompression from heavy concrete, due to which the exact size and high density of the walls are obtained. Used to form and stack a concrete well.

Concrete cover

This element of reinforced concrete wells is made of high-strength concrete. It is used as an overlapping plate at the completion of installation of well rings. The covers have a round shape and an opening from above, on which the hatch rests. This structural element prevents foreign objects from entering and protects against contamination. A lid is made for a well made of heavy concrete and without reinforcement, thereby providing increased strength and reliability.

Bottom for a well

This is an important and necessary element for prefabricated wells, which is a reinforced concrete monolithic plate of round shape. The bottom first descends into the well shaft. From above on it rings of a well and a cover with the hatch are fastened. It is on how well it is made and correctly installed, the efficiency of using the well depends.

Types and purposes of the wells

By designation ZHB-wells are divided into several types:

  • Sewage (treatment, drainage). Designed to create a sewerage system in the areas of pipe changes, bends, etc.
  • Water supply. Served as elements of heat and water supply, water supply network.
  • Gas-conducting. They are elements of the main gas pipelines.

In terms of functionality, a concrete well can be:

  1. Lookout. Serves to control the operation of the entire system.
  2. Differently. Used when turning the network, in places where there are strong pipe changes, when pipelines of different depths are combined into one network, and so on.
  3. Turning. It is used in the place where the pipes rotate to prevent blockage. In addition, it is often used as a review.
  4. Filtration (filtering). Required for sewage treatment. The reinforced concrete well is installed above the water table.
  5. Accumulative. It is used for accumulation of wastewater and is most often installed at the lowest point of the plot in order to ensure the optimum slope of the sewage pipeline.

Mounting Features

The process of assembling ferro-concrete wells is performed in several stages:

  1. First of all, it is necessary to clearly define the place where the well will be built. It should not be installed on the slopes of ravines, gullies, banks of rivers, because then they will take groundwater. In addition, an important negative factor is the contamination of groundwater by various chemical fertilizers, which are used in adjacent areas and fall into the ground through emissions and sewage production.
  2. After choosing a place, they begin to work on punching directly the shaft of the well (shaft). This process is quite laborious and depends largely on the depth of the soil and the aquifer. Using modern technology allows you to drill very quickly.
  3. The incoming water is pumped out.
  4. Filling and tamping of the filter layers is performed. Then carefully install the first ring. It is from the correctness of its installation that the verticality of the mine depends.
  5. To carry out the assembly of the rings, as a rule, use lifting equipment or special devices, installed directly above the shaft.
  6. After each installation of the ring, metal fasteners are fastened, which are subsequently used as a ladder for work in the well.
  7. Connections between the rings are sealed, and the free space between the walls of the concrete rings is covered with soil and carefully compacted.
  8. The hatch is covered with clay, ventilation is installed, and the lid is closed with a lid.

Size and price

The size of the rings depends on the type of well. Today's construction market offers the following products:

  • Diameter - within the range of 70-250 cm.
  • The average height is 50 cm (there are products up to 3 m)

For small wells in private construction small rings are used. The most popular are:

  • COP-7-1. The inner diameter of this product is 70 cm, the height of the walls is 10 cm, the width is 8 cm, weight is 46 kg.
  • COP-7-10. This is a universal product, whose height is 1 m, weight - 457 kg.

The price of concrete rings depends on their size. Larger products are more expensive.

For example, small COP-7-1 cost an average of 340 rubles. for a unit. The cost of COP-7-5 and КС-7-6 is 900-920 rubles. The price of universal brands KS-7-10 is about 1500 rubles. The largest rings will cost about 5,000 rubles.
